Output 68abd8ece4f031817167fe9d93e55b2ebb5ce9929dd58ca905c4ca576fa0aae6:1

value
444837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 348b9eec7c12c612a9f26094e952741a976aa7b8 OP_EQUAL
address
36UrKYPEnudXkmLi2VUwHQ2TynGpU8U9s5
transaction
68abd8ece4f031817167fe9d93e55b2ebb5ce9929dd58ca905c4ca576fa0aae6
confirmations
350969
spent
true